UserSplit Cutover Drift: the extracted account service and the legacy Marigold monolith user module are reporting divergent record counts during dual-write. This fires when drift exceeds 0.5% over 15 minutes. New team members should not replay writes manually. Reconciliation steps and the rollback procedure are documented on the internal page.

wiki page, tajog-fafog: https://gitlab.paliqsys.corp/dash/display/job/853dd6fcbf54

Action item (P2, owner: release manager): During the Varrow outage, responders couldn't tail ingest logs because the `tailgate` CLI shipped in 4.2 broke flag parsing for multi-region targets. Fix is merged but unreleased. Before next cut: verify `tailgate --region` against staging, add the regression case to the release checklist, and block promotion until the smoke suite passes. Do not hand-patch binaries on bastion hosts again; that caused version drift last time. The verification steps and checklist template are on the internal page.

dashboard of bafof-hafog = https://confluence.lumiclabs.internal/display/browse/display/6a09a20a

Subject: DR drill — Rotavault

Team,

Friday's drill covers Rotavault, our secrets-rotation utility. We'll simulate loss of the primary keystore in the Blenheim cluster and restore from cold escrow. Owen runs the clock; I observe. Expect a 20-minute rotation freeze. If restore stalls, unlock the escrow bundle manually. The escrow unlock passphrase is as follows.

strongbox words: kelix-rusael-fravan-tameth-briax-fraael-praiel

Q3 Planning Note — Marketing Reduction (Stonegarth Instruments)

Marketing budget is cut 20% for Q3. Paid search and the Hallowbeck trade circuit are suspended. Lead volume will drop an estimated 12–15%; sales leads should adjust pipeline targets accordingly. Inbound routing stays unchanged. Co-marketing funds for the Ardent partner tier are protected. Collateral refresh for the Lanwick product line is deferred to Q4. Raise coverage gaps at the Monday planning call. The strategic note below explains the rationale for these moves.

board note of bawep-tajef: Queniusek Systems plans to raise the Quenvan list price by 53.1 percent in March. The pricing group signed off on a budget of $176.4 million for Project Drueth. The renewal with Casionix Partners closes at $142.5 million a year, 8.3 percent below the last contract. Project Fraax slips by six weeks because of the tooling delay.